Spurs upgrade frontcourt depth with Tarris Reed at 26 after Nuggets swap

San Antonio traded the 35th pick and two future second-round selections to Denver to move up to No. 26 and select 6’10 center Tarris Reed from UConn. The 22-year-old, known for a traditional back-to-the-basket game, averaged 9.6 points, 7.3 rebounds and 1.6 blocks while shooting 64.4% from the floor last season, providing immediate size behind Victor Wembanyama and Luke Kornet as a long-term project with potential day-one contribution.

Quaintance Knee Issue Won’t Haunt Career; Clean-Up Could Come Before NBA Debut

A top knee doctor says Kentucky forward Jayden Quaintance’s knee isn’t expected to be a long‑term concern ahead of the 2026 NBA Draft; a secondary evaluation suggests a potential cleanup procedure to address the injury, which could sideline him for up to six months but would aim for a durable, long NBA career. His ACL is intact, and the move could gap his rookie season, though it helped secure his No. 20 selection by the San Antonio Spurs in the 2026 draft after predraft workouts.

Spurs roll the dice on Jayden Quaintance at No. 20, banking on upside

San Antonio selected Jayden Quaintance with the 20th pick in the 2026 NBA Draft. The 6-foot-9 center, coming off a college stretch at Arizona State, is praised for elite rim protection but carries injury risk after tearing his ACL in February 2025 and limited play last season. The pick fits the Spurs’ pattern of patience with upside prospects and provides potential interior depth behind Victor Wembanyama, with veteran Luke Kornet as a backup option.

Oweh’s Draft Stock Surges as Mock Drafts Eye Bulls Fit

Kentucky’s Otega Oweh is rising in NBA mock drafts after a strong NBA Draft Combine, with CBS Sports projecting him at No. 38 to the Chicago Bulls (via a trade). Other outlets vary, placing him later (e.g., 43 to the Nets, 50–56 range) as teams weigh medicals and his two-way potential, while teammate Quaintance also climbs. In short, Oweh’s improved athleticism, scoring, defense and spot-up shooting have him trending toward a first-to-second-round selection.

"Top Recruit Jayden Quaintance Seeks Release from Kentucky Commitment"

Five-star forward Jayden Quaintance, the highest-ranked member of Kentucky's 2024 recruiting class, has requested a release from his letter of intent following coach John Calipari's departure to Arkansas. This comes after another recruit, Karter Knox, also reopened his recruitment. Quaintance, ranked No. 14 in the ESPN 100, reclassified to 2024 to play in college a year earlier but may have to spend two years in college before entering the NBA draft due to his age. With Quaintance and Knox out, Kentucky's once highly-ranked recruiting class is now down to four ESPN 100 prospects.

"Top Recruit Jayden Quaintance Seeks NLI Release from Kentucky Amid Coaching Changes"

Five-Star Plus+ center Jayden Quaintance has requested his release from his National Letter of Intent with Kentucky following the departure of head coach John Calipari, who resigned to join Arkansas. Quaintance, the nation’s No. 8 overall prospect in the 2024 cycle, had chosen Kentucky over Missouri and held offers from other prominent programs. His physical presence and skills make him a highly sought-after recruit. Kentucky's 2024 class has seen some changes, with Quaintance's request adding to the shifts in the team's recruiting landscape.

Jayden Quaintance Chooses Kentucky Wildcats for College Basketball

Five-star center Jayden Quaintance has committed to the University of Kentucky, choosing the Wildcats over the Missouri Tigers. Quaintance, ranked as the No. 4 overall player and No. 1 center, is a highly sought-after recruit. At just 16 years old, he will spend at least two years at the post-high school level before potentially entering the NBA. Quaintance's commitment adds to Kentucky's strong recruiting class, positioning them as one of the top teams in college basketball.
